When I first started quilting I used cones given to me by my SIL who worked in the local Laura Ashley factory. I had loads of trouble with them - breaking, & masses of lint so they were relegated to basting thread and I gave away alot of them for that purpose. I then bought new serger thread and that was much better and I carried on using that for years. However a couple of years ago 3 of my first quilts have been returned for repair and all the seams were coming apart.(They would be about 15yrs old) I just put them on a another backing and free machined them. Anyway my point is that since then I haven't used serger thread or polyester cos that melts as I like using very hot iron and my favourite is masterpiece from superior threads with bottomline in the bobbin.
